Abstract
6,8,9-Trisubstituted purine analogues were efficiently synthesized via cycl ization of 6-chloro-4,5-diaminopyrimidines and various aldehydes promoted b y FeCl3-SiO2. Fe(III) chloride on silica gel has a dual role of a dehydrati on agent and an oxidant, and was conveniently removed during work-up by fil tration. (C) 2000 Elsevier Science Ltd. All rights reserved.
